The climate in Kansas, with its hot summers and severe winters, places considerable demand on garage door bottom seals. Extreme temperatures can cause traditional rubber or vinyl seals to become brittle and crack in the cold, or soften and degrade in the heat, compromising their ability to prevent the ingress of wind, dust, and moisture. The prevalence of agricultural activity in many Kansas regions also contributes to airborne particulate matter, necessitating robust sealing solutions to maintain interior garage environments. When evaluating service providers for garage door bottom seal replacement or repair in Kansas, it is prudent to inquire about the specific materials utilized, such as EPDM rubber or heavy-duty vinyl compounds engineered for resilience against rapid temperature shifts and UV exposure. A thorough assessment of the existing seal's condition, including any signs of wear, tearing, or detachment from the door's lower edge, is a critical precursor to selecting the appropriate replacement component and installation methodology.

Is it worth fixing a garage door spring?

Repairing a garage door spring is generally considered a worthwhile investment, especially when compared to the cost of a complete garage door replacement. A functioning spring is critical for safe operation, preventing undue stress on the opener mechanism and protecting against potential damage or injury. Prompt attention to a damaged spring preserves the longevity of the entire system.

Can you fix a garage door spring by yourself?

Attempting to repair a garage door spring independently is strongly discouraged due to the extreme tension involved, which poses a significant safety hazard. Improper handling can lead to severe injury. Professional technicians possess the specialized tools and expertise necessary to safely manage and replace these critical components.

What is the average life of a garage door spring?

The average lifespan of a garage door spring is typically measured in cycles, often ranging from 10,000 to 20,000 cycles, with some higher-quality springs exceeding this benchmark. Factors influencing this duration include the frequency of door operation, the weight of the garage door, and environmental conditions such as humidity and temperature extremes experienced in Kansas.
